Web20 uur geleden · optical. Ferritin is an iron-storage protein that exists in large quantities in bacteria, plants, and the blood of many mammals, including humans. (1−3) This intracellular protein naturally stores iron and releases it in a controlled fashion. Ferritin plays a key role in preventing diseases and in the detoxification of metals in living organisms.

WebLow ferritin with hemoglobin in the mid- to upper normal range is at best a relative indication for iron supplementation: low ferritin with hemoglobin in the low normal range is a stronger, yet still relative, indication for iron supplementation in athletes.
